The I Spy Preschool Hack Teachers Swear By For Focus is a visual search game. It sharpens sustained attention and eases screen fatigue. Children scan pictures to locate hidden items using clues. Studies indicate brief, playful focus tasks help early learners regulate attention.

Why this simple game actually holds attention. Kids practice listening and compare details to images. They must filter out distractions to spot the right object. Research shows active scanning strengthens working memory in preschoolers. Small groups or one child can play with any picture set.

This game builds calm, alert learning habits.
